The Corsair HS50 is $50 and from what I've heard is better than the Cloud Stinger. It is just as comfortable and has a less "gamery" feel to it so if you want to take it with you somewhere you can just pop of the detachable mic and it will look like a normal pair of headphones.

https://www.amazon.com/Cooler-Master-MH-751-Neodymium-Omni-Directional/dp/B07JH3LSHN/ref=sr_1_3?crid=1ODQYJCS9Z0T1&keywords=cooler+master+headset&qid=1551250548&s=electronics&sprefix=cooler+master+head%2Celectronics%2C-1&sr=1-3 grab these while they are on sale they are new but they are great. I'm pretty sure these will soon become the new cloud 2 alternatives. these are  comfy  AF and sound better than cloud 2's. coolers master took takstar pro 82's  really good closed back and made them better and also put a mic on them and it resulted in this headset.
